Handover note — Crumbwheel order cutoffs.

Welcome aboard. The bakery cutoff rule in Crumbwheel closes same-day orders at 14:00 local to each storefront, not UTC — this has bitten us twice. Holiday overrides live in the calendar service and take precedence silently, so always check there first when a cutoff looks wrong. To unlock the calendar service's admin console after a restart, enter the recovery passphrase below.

vault phrase of bagap-bahaf = silion-pelox-sorox-casdor-quenwyn-fraax-eliox-praael-kelion-quenvan-kasox-rusael-norius-belvan

## Data Stores: Report Exports

All timestamps in Fernwick exports are stored UTC; conversion to tenant timezone happens at render time only. If a customer reports shifted rows, check the tenant's tz column, not the export job. Never patch timestamps in place. To inspect the exports schema directly, use the connection string below.

primary connection of yagep-kahip = redis://giliel_svc:zYiKsLL2PLpfPL@db-348f.xolmarsys.corp:5432/fenwyn

**Runbook: When Hushfield dedup goes quiet (or too loud)**

If on-call pages suddenly triple, Hushfield's deduplicator probably lost its fingerprint cache after a pod restart — it takes about ten minutes to rebuild, so don't panic-restart it again. If instead alerts stop entirely, check that the grouping window isn't stuck at its max; a stale config push does this. Flush the window via the admin endpoint and confirm new alerts flow within two minutes. When you file the incident note, include the build token shown below.

build token for kagaf-hahof: htk14_9d3d4d26d7d8de

Attendees: senior leadership of Quorvane Retail Group. The meeting reviewed the proposed replacement of the Emberpoints scheme with a tiered model. Finance noted accrual liability must be restated before launch; marketing confirmed creative work is underway. Migration of existing balances was approved in principle, pending cost modelling due next month. Pilot regions were agreed as Delmsworth and Carrow Vale. Actions were assigned with a two-week review cycle. The confidential planning note appears directly below.

internal memo for kawep-haweg: Only 15 of the 365 pilot accounts renewed Briiel, so a churn review is set for October 3. Sorixek Systems is in early talks to buy Lamaelox Works for about $25.8 million.